How do metal sculptures adapt to indoor climate-controlled environments?

Author:Editor Time:2025-04-11 Browse:



Metal sculptures, while durable, require careful consideration when placed in climate-controlled indoor environments. Temperature and humidity fluctuations can significantly impact their longevity and appearance.

Indoor climate control systems help maintain stable conditions, preventing common issues like oxidation, condensation, and thermal expansion. Ideally, relative humidity should be kept between 40-50% to minimize corrosion risks. Temperature stability is equally crucial, as rapid changes can cause metal fatigue or stress fractures.

Different metals react uniquely to indoor conditions. Bronze sculptures, for instance, develop protective patinas over time, while stainless steel remains relatively unaffected by humidity. Regular maintenance, including dusting and occasional wax coatings, enhances preservation.

Modern museums and galleries often use specialized display cases with microclimate controls for valuable pieces. These systems filter pollutants and maintain optimal conditions. For private collectors, simple solutions like silica gel packets can help regulate moisture near displayed artworks.

Understanding these adaptation mechanisms ensures metal sculptures retain their beauty and structural integrity for generations in indoor settings. Proper placement away from direct HVAC vents and sunlight further enhances their preservation.
